Carroll Creek Linear Park in Frederick, MD, is a beautiful destination for tourists seeking scenic walks, vibrant art, and peaceful relaxation. This picturesque park offers a delightful escape into nature with its charming pathways, lush greenery, and stunning views of the creek. Perfect for families, couples, or solo travelers, the park is an ideal spot for leisurely strolls, picnics, and enjoying public art installations that line the pathways.

Walking
If you are starting from downtown Frederick, walk south on Market Street until you reach East Patrick Street. Turn right on East Patrick Street. Continue walking until you reach the intersection with Carroll Creek. Carroll Creek Linear Park will be on your left, with accessible pathways along the creek.
Biking
If you have a bike, you can start from Baker Park. Exit the park and head east on East 2nd Street towards North Market Street. Turn left onto North Market Street and follow it until you reach East Patrick Street. Turn right on East Patrick Street, and Carroll Creek Linear Park will be on your left.
Public Transport
If you are near the Frederick Transit Station, board the bus route that goes towards the downtown area. Get off at the Market Street stop. From there, walk south on Market Street to East Patrick Street, then turn right. Carroll Creek Linear Park will be on your left.
